    The National Association of Hispanic Journalists extends its gratitude to the Robert R. McCormick Tribune Foundation and the John S. and James L. Knight Foundation for their generous support of the Parity Project.

    McCormick Tribune


    The Robert R. McCormick Tribune Foundation is a charitable grant making organization that supports work in journalism, communities, citizenship, and education.

    The John S. and James L. Knight Foundation, a private foundation independent of the Knight brothers' newspaper enterprises, is dedicated to furthering their ideals of service to community, to the highest standards of journalistic excellence and to the defense of a free press.

    University of Southern California Annenberg School of Journalism offers award winning academic programs in the fields of print, photo, broadcast and online media. USC Annenberg School of Journalism provides work space for the associate director of the the Parity Project based in Los Angeles.
